“We Should’ve Learned This In School” – It’s Time to Become Your Own Teacher

One of the most annoying things on social media is “We should’ve learned this in school…” posts. Stop making excuses and take control of your own education.

I agree that there are many important topics we would’ve benefitted from learning in school. It would’ve been nice to know about investing, taxes, paying bills, insurance, and many other things earlier than adulthood. But guess what, we didn’t learn it, so move on and do something about it.

My teachers didn’t teach me how to invest – I did. No one told me about high interest savings accounts – I discovered them. I wasn’t taught how to properly use credit and debt to my advantage – until I took it upon myself. We both started in the same position, but one of us did something to escape the ignorance.

Each of us has the ability to learn anything we desire. If you feel you were “cheated” or not adequately educated in certain topics, pick up a book. You are just as capable of studying something as the person who did. With all the resources available, you have no excuses.

You cannot change the past. You have no say in what you did or didn’t learn, but you have the power to change your present circumstances and knowledge.

We all start at zero. We all have to grow our knowledge and understanding of the world over time, so the best thing you can do is start now.
